Understanding Plus Size Sizing in the UK

When shopping for a plus size cheongsam dress in the UK, understanding the sizing differences between the UK and other regions, particularly the US, is crucial. UK sizing typically uses numerical measurements (e.g., 16, 18, 20) while US sizing often employs a combination of numbers and letters (e.g., 14W, 16W). A UK size 18, for example, roughly translates to a US size 16W. This discrepancy can lead to confusion, especially when purchasing from international retailers. To avoid sizing mishaps, always refer to the brand's specific sizing chart and consider consulting customer reviews for real-world fit insights.

Common sizing issues include garments being too tight around the bust or hips or too loose around the waist. These problems often arise from inconsistent sizing standards across brands. To mitigate this, take your measurements regularly, as body shapes can change over time. Additionally, look for brands that offer detailed sizing guides and customer support to help you find the perfect fit. Remember, a well-fitted cheongsam dress should hug your curves without restricting movement or causing discomfort.

Key Measurements for a Perfect Cheongsam Fit

Accurate measurements are the foundation of a perfectly fitted cheongsam dress. The four key measurements to focus on are bust, waist, hips, and shoulders. To measure your bust, wrap the tape around the fullest part of your chest, ensuring it's parallel to the ground. For the waist, measure the narrowest part of your torso, typically just above the belly button. The hips should be measured at the widest part of your lower body, usually around the buttocks. Shoulder width is measured from the edge of one shoulder to the other.

Taking these measurements at home requires a flexible measuring tape and a mirror to ensure accuracy. Wear form-fitting clothing or undergarments to get the most precise measurements. It's also helpful to have a friend assist you, as self-measuring can sometimes lead to errors. Record your measurements in both inches and centimeters, as different brands may use different units. Keep these measurements updated, as even small changes can affect the fit of your cheongsam dress.

Deciphering Cheongsam Sizing Charts

Cheongsam sizing charts can vary significantly between brands, making it essential to understand how to interpret them. Most charts will list measurements for bust, waist, and hips, corresponding to specific dress sizes. For example, a UK size 18 might correspond to a bust of 42 inches, a waist of 34 inches, and hips of 44 inches. However, some brands may include additional measurements like shoulder width or armhole size, which are particularly important for cheongsam dresses due to their fitted nature.

Converting your measurements to dress sizes can be tricky, especially if your proportions don't align perfectly with the chart. In such cases, it's often best to size up and have the dress altered for a better fit. Pay attention to the brand's return policy, as some may offer free returns or exchanges if the size isn't right. If you're between sizes, consider reaching out to customer service for personalized advice.

Fit Tips for Different Body Shapes

Apple-shaped bodies typically carry weight around the midsection, so a cheongsam dress that accentuates the waist is ideal. Look for styles with empire waists or ruching around the waist to create a flattering silhouette. Avoid overly tight fabrics that may emphasize the midsection. Instead, opt for structured materials that provide support and shape.

Pear-shaped bodies have wider hips compared to the bust, so balancing the proportions is key. A-line or flared cheongsam dresses can help create a harmonious look. Details like embellishments or patterns on the upper body can draw attention upward, while darker colors on the lower half can minimize the hips.

Hourglass bodies are characterized by a well-defined waist and balanced bust and hips. Fitted cheongsam dresses that highlight the natural curves are perfect for this body type. Look for styles with side slits or high necklines to enhance the overall look. Avoid boxy or shapeless designs that may hide your natural proportions.

Alterations and Customization

Finding a skilled tailor is essential for achieving the perfect fit, especially for plus size cheongsam dresses. Look for tailors with experience in working with Asian-inspired garments, as they will understand the unique construction of a cheongsam. Ask for recommendations from friends or online communities, and check reviews before committing to a tailor.

Custom-made cheongsam dresses are another excellent option for plus size women. Many UK-based designers offer bespoke services, allowing you to choose the fabric, design, and fit that best suits your body. While custom options may be more expensive, the investment is often worth it for a garment that fits perfectly and makes you feel confident.
